*COMING CLEAN BEFORE OUR CREATOR:
Gracious God:
We know that all our failures and shortcomings
Stand revealed in the clear light of Your goodness.
We ask Your forgiveness.
Forgive our pride, hardness of heart,
Self sufficiency, and willful wrongdoing.
Forgive our readiness to blame, and our lack
Of thoughtfulness, patience, kindness, and sympathy.
Forgive our sins, and let the mind of Christ be formed in us! Amen.
